Safety Guidelines
- Always operate the drone in open areas, away from people, animals, buildings, and power lines.
- Ensure the drone battery and remote control battery are fully charged before each flight.
- Do not fly in strong winds (Max Wind Speed Resistance: <10).
- Maintain visual line of sight with the drone at all times.
- Familiarize yourself with local drone regulations and restrictions.
- Perform pre-flight checks, including propeller installation and camera security.
- Avoid flying near airports or restricted airspace.
- In case of emergency, use the one-click return function.

Operating Instructions
1. Pre-Flight Checklist
- Ensure drone and remote control batteries are fully charged.
- Check that propellers are securely attached.
- Select an open, clear area for flight, away from obstacles and people.
- Power on the drone, then the remote control.
- Wait for GPS signal acquisition (indicated on the remote control screen).
2. Basic Flight Controls
- **Take-off**: Press the one-key take-off button or push both joysticks outwards and downwards to unlock motors, then push the throttle stick up.
- **Landing**: Press the one-key landing button or slowly pull the throttle stick down.
- **Hovering**: The drone features optical flow visual hovering for stable flight, especially useful for novices.
- **Movement**: Use the direction lever to control forward, backward, left, and right movement.
- **Altitude**: Use the throttle stick to ascend or descend.
- **Multi-speed Mode**: Adjust flight speed using the 'Speed' button on the remote control for different flight experiences.

Maintenance
- **Cleaning**: Gently wipe the drone and remote control with a soft, dry cloth after each use. Avoid using harsh chemicals.
- **Propellers**: Regularly inspect propellers for damage (cracks, bends). Replace any damaged propellers immediately using the provided spare parts and screwdriver.
- **Batteries**: Store batteries in a cool, dry place, away from direct sunlight. Do not overcharge or over-discharge.
- **Storage**: When not in use, store the drone and accessories in the provided storage bag to protect them from dust and damage.
- **Firmware Updates**: Check the official website or app for any available firmware updates to ensure optimal performance and access to new features.
Troubleshooting
| Problem | Possible Solution |
|---|---|
| Drone does not power on. | Ensure the drone battery is fully charged and correctly installed. Check the power button. |
| Remote control does not connect to drone. | Ensure both devices are powered on. Re-pair the remote control with the drone according to the quick start guide. Check battery levels. |
| Poor image transmission quality or lag. | Ensure you are within the 3-5KM transmission range. Avoid areas with strong signal interference. Check data cable connection if using wired transmission. |
| Drone drifts during flight. | Perform a compass calibration. Ensure GPS signal is strong before take-off. Check for strong winds. |
| Obstacle avoidance not working. | Ensure the obstacle avoidance sensors are clean and unobstructed. Verify the feature is enabled in settings. |
| Drone does not respond to commands. | Check remote control battery. Ensure drone and remote are properly linked. Land immediately if possible and restart. |
